    Unseen Danger

    You might think, “What’s the big deal about radon?” Well, let’s break it down. Radioactive radon gas is highly toxic if exposed to it over the long term. It is an invisible radioactive gas that forms naturally from the breakdown of uranium in soil and rocks. You can’t see, smell, or taste it, but it’s lurking in places like your basement.

    Infiltration Pathways

    So, how does Radon get into your home? It seeps in through cracks in the foundation, gaps around pipes, or even your sump basin. Essentially, anywhere there’s a pathway from the ground into your home, Radon can find its way in.

    Health Risks

    Prolonged exposure to Radon is bad for your health. While small amounts of Radon are usually harmless because they disperse quickly, breathing in high levels over time can damage your lungs and increase your risk of developing lung cancer. The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) estimates that approximately 21,000 deaths each year are attributable to radon-induced lung cancer. In fact, it says Radon is the second leading cause of lung cancer in the United States, right after smoking. And if you’re a smoker living in a radon-rich environment, your risk is even higher.

    Why you should test for Radon in your home

    • The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) recommends that the standard for Radon in air is 4 pCi/L or less. And that your home be tested every two years.
    • Only a professional test administered by a certified inspector can confirm a home or building is radon-free. 
    • Both the Wisconsin Department of Health Services (DHS) and the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) recommend taking action to reduce indoor air radon levels to a level of 4 picocuries per liter (pCi/L) or less.
    • A Radon test costs between $150 and $175, and the equipment can be in your home for about a week.
    • Radon mitigation costs are relatively affordable. Several factors, including the home’s location, design and size and the type of foundation, determine the cost. However, a certified contractor can install a radon mitigation system for around $1,200, although it can range from $800 to $2,000. Get more info at Wisconsin DHS and Illinois IEMA
    • The states of Wisconsin and Illinois do not require the seller to take any corrective action if the home tests high for Radon. However, the seller is legally obligated to disclose the radon test results to potential buyers.
